public interface Synthesizer extends MidiDevice
Synthesizer generates sound. This usually happens when one of the
Synthesizer's
MidiChannel objects receives a
noteOn message, either directly or via the
Synthesizer object. Many
Synthesizers support
Receivers, through which MIDI events can be delivered to the
Synthesizer. In such cases, the
Synthesizer typically responds by sending a corresponding message to the appropriate
MidiChannel, or by processing the event itself if the event isn't one of the MIDI channel messages.
The Synthesizer interface includes methods for loading and unloading instruments from soundbanks. An instrument is a specification for synthesizing a certain type of sound, whether that sound emulates a traditional instrument or is some kind of sound effect or other imaginary sound. A soundbank is a collection of instruments, organized by bank and program number (via the instrument's Patch object). Different Synthesizer classes might implement different sound-synthesis techniques, meaning that some instruments and not others might be compatible with a given synthesizer. Also, synthesizers may have a limited amount of memory for instruments, meaning that not every soundbank and instrument can be used by every synthesizer, even if the synthesis technique is compatible. To see whether the instruments from a certain soundbank can be played by a given synthesizer, invoke the isSoundbankSupported method of Synthesizer.
"Loading" an instrument means that that instrument becomes available for synthesizing notes. The instrument is loaded into the bank and program location specified by its Patch object. Loading does not necessarily mean that subsequently played notes will immediately have the sound of this newly loaded instrument. For the instrument to play notes, one of the synthesizer's MidiChannel objects must receive (or have received) a program-change message that causes that particular instrument's bank and program number to be selected.

long getLatency()
Although the latency is expressed in microseconds, a synthesizer's actual measured delay may vary over a wider range than this resolution suggests. For example, a synthesizer might have a worst-case delay of a few milliseconds or more.
MidiChannel[] getChannels()
MidiChannel that receives the MIDI messages sent on that channel number.
The MIDI 1.0 specification provides for 16 channels, so this method returns an array of at least 16 elements. However, if this synthesizer doesn't make use of all 16 channels, some of the elements of the array might be null, so you should check each element before using it.

Instrument[] getAvailableInstruments()
Note that you don't use this method to find out which instruments are currently loaded onto the synthesizer; for that purpose, you use getLoadedInstruments(). Nor does the method indicate all the instruments that can be loaded onto the synthesizer; it only indicates the subset that come with the synthesizer. To learn whether another instrument can be loaded, you can invoke isSoundbankSupported(), and if the instrument's Soundbank is supported, you can try loading the instrument.
